A method to extract the frequency, location, width and … WebThe flow patterns and progressive damage of dike overtopping are investigated. Two types of phenomena at the dike surface: erosion; and erosion and sliding, are observed during the overtopping event. Four stages of dike damage can be distinguished. The degradation rate of the dike crest is found to be dependent on the downstream slope of …

WebRCC overtopping protection for embankment dams is generally limited to emergency spillways that would only operate for flood return periods of 100 years or greater. RCC has a wide application for use as overtopping protection since the material is suitable for a wide range of flow depths and velocities.
